CVE-2026-84207 | Heymrun Heym up to 0.0.97 WebSocket Send/Trigger Nodes server-side request forgery
A vulnerability was found in Heymrun Heym up to 0.0.97. It has been rated as problematic. The affected element is an unknown function of the component WebSocket Send/Trigger Nodes. The manipulation leads to server-side request forgery.
This vulnerability is listed as CVE-2026-84207. The attack may be initiated remotely. There is no available exploit.
